Synopsis of Elmer Gantry
a new American opera
Elmer Gantry is a new American opera based on Sinclair Lewis' famous satirical novel from 1927 that follows the adventures of a fraudulent, womanizing evangelist. Elmer, a small-town football hero with the gift of gab, falls in love with and becomes business manager for a beautiful traveling evangelist, Sharon Falconer. He helps her realize her dream of building a magnificent tabernacle before his misdeeds bring ruin to them both. The music for Elmer Gantry places traditional operatic forms - arias, duets and large ensembles - into a boldly American, vernacular, and ‘roots'-based musical language. Original hymns and gospel choruses help to tell this quintessentially American story of religion, love and corruption.
